A sample of seawater has a pH of 8. determine the new pH of the sample if the hydrogen ion concentration is increased by a factor of 100

Explanation:
pH = - log[H⁺]
8 = - log[H⁺]
[H⁺] = 10⁻⁸
if this concentration of hydrogen ion increases to 100 times
New hydrogen ion concentration
[H⁺] = 10⁻⁸ x 10²
= 10⁻⁶
pH = - log[10⁻⁶]
= 6
new pH will be 6 .
